和 Tweet 有關的API
- GET/api/tweets 取得全部tweet資料
- POST/api/tweets 新增tweet
- GET/api/tweets/:tweetId 取得單一tweet資料
和 Reply 有關的API
- POST/api/tweets/:id/replies 新增reply
- GET /api/tweets/:tweet_id/replies取得單一tweet的reply
和 User 有關的API
- POST/api/users 註冊帳號
- POST/api/signin 登入
- PUT/api/users/:id 個人首頁的編輯使用者
- PUT/api/users/account/setting 使用者側邊欄設定
- GET/api/users/top 右側邊欄前十名追蹤數使用者
- GET/api/users/:id 使用者個人頁面
- GET/api/users/account 取得當前使用者個人資訊
- GET/api/users/:userId/tweets 使用者所有推文
- GET/api/users/:userId/likes 使用者點過的like